Kueh Pieti

For some reason I had this craving for Kueh Pieti when I went to Cold Storage.

Ingredients: 
200g Minced Pork
Several Pieces of Chinese Cabbage
Some Kueh Pieti shells
A Turnip
Several Sting beans
Half a Taro Shoot (Bamboo Shoot
Some Pieces of Crabstick
1 Egg
Some Parsley
Four Prawns.
Red Onion
Garlic
Soy Sauce
Black pepper.
Soy Bean Sauce

Steps: Prepare Ingredients. Slice the string beans and carrot Diagonal wise. Make sure to soak the Taro Shoot in salt water before use, to get rid of the smell. Peel the prawns and cut each into three pieces. Julienne the turnip and cabbage. chop up the parsley and mix it into the minced pork. Cube the Taro Shoot and slice the crabstick into thin slices.


After that fry some oil and put garlic until it turns golden brown, add some chopped red onion and fry until it becomes fragrant. Put in the minced pork and shrimp and fry for about 5 minutes. Add some soy sauce and black pepper.

 Add the Carrots and string beans to the minced pork and shrimp and continue to stir fry. Then add in the Taro shoot, turnip and cabbage and fry together until the cabbage is fully cooked. Plate the filling.
 
Crack the egg and mix in a frying pan to make an omelet like egg. plate that also. Cut up the egg into small slices. Put the filling into the Kueh Pieti cups and top it with the sliced egg and crabstick. add some soybean sauce into the cups for taste.
